> >> It's called Finding Happiness and is a Hollywood filmmaker's inside look at
> >> a spiritual community in Ca called Ananda. It stars Elisabeth Rohm (
> >> Law & Order, American Hustle). Here's a short synopsis:
> >>
> >> This movie follows an investigative reporter (Rohm) sent, not too willingly,
> >> to report on a spiritual community in Ca. With a fair portion of
> >> skepticism and a dash of curiosity, she finds herself in a place of
> >> exquisite beauty, and is transformed by what she sees and feels there. The
> >> reporter is fiction; the people and the place are extraordinary.
